§ 187. Liens of truckmen and draymen.

1.Every person, firm or\ncorporation engaged in carting or trucking property shall have a lien\nupon such property and may retain such portion of the property in his\npossession as will insure to the said truckman or drayman, at the sale\nof such property in the manner hereinafter provided, a fair and\nreasonable compensation for the material and labor furnished, including\nany moneys advanced by such bailee for hire in connection with such\nwork. Such truckman or drayman shall have such lien and may retain such\nproperty only as provided in paragraph two of this section.\n 2.
